    Requirements for mobile power distribution boxes at outdoor construction sites

    Construction site temporary installations must use 110V CTE for portable tools, IP-rated distribution boards, 30 mA RCD protection on every circuit, and quarterly EICR inspections. This guide covers BS 7375, BS 7671 Section 704, and everything electricians need to know about site.     Power is supplied from the distribution cabinet to the busbar box

    Busbars carry power from the transformer to the low-voltage switchgear—in other words, the switches, fuses or circuit breakers that control, protect and isolate the electrical equipment. In a typical office building, the busbar system is installed under the raised floor. Traditional panel wiring systems — referred to as block-and-cable systems — are designed around large power distribution blocks (PDBs) that require large parallel cables. Each PDB feeds a specific part of the control panel, which, as enclosures continue to require more power in service of. Busbars are metallic strips or bars, typically made of copper or aluminum, that conduct electricity within a distribution system. They serve as the primary means of distributing power from incoming feeders to outgoing circuits. Yes! A Bus Bar Box is a high-capacity compact system used to replace traditional wiring and is called an alternative device.

    Korean GGD power distribution box

    GGD type low-voltage fixed switchgear is suitable for power substation, power plant, factory and mining enterprises and other power users of AC 50Hz, rated working voltage 380V, rated working current 3150A below the power distribution system, as power, lighting and. GGD type low-voltage fixed switchgear is suitable for power substation, power plant, factory and mining enterprises and other power users of AC 50Hz, rated working voltage 380V, rated working current 3150A below the power distribution system, as power, lighting and. The product is of high breaking capacity, rated short-time withstand current up to 50kA. It has the below characteristics of flexible route scheme; convenient assembly; strong practicability and novel structure. The product complies with IEC439< low voltage switchgear and control equipment >. GGD type fixed enclosed low-voltage switchgear is suitable for the power station, substation, industrial and mining enterprises and other power users. AC 50/60 Hz, rated working voltage to 660V, rated working current to 3150A.
